snail that looks like an Iso????


this is some sort of snail but i cant figure out what kind, at first I thought it was the dreaded large isopod but no legs just a snail but shell when you mess with it rolls up like a pill bug and is hard as a rock, like to never got it off of the rock.. anyone know what kind it is, never seen it till now but dont need anything getting eaten on me.
